| Regimental number | 279 |
| Place of birth | Goulburn New South Wales |
| Religion | Church of England |
| Occupation | Signal fitter |
| Address | Belmore Park, Bowral, New South Wales |
| Marital status | Single |
| Age at embarkation | 39 |
| Next of kin | J Richards, Bellmore Park, Bowral, New South Wales |
| Enlistment date | 19 August 1914 |
| Rank on enlistment | Private |
| Unit name | 1st Light Horse Regiment, B Squadron |
| AWM Embarkation Roll number | 10/6/1 |
| Embarkation details | Unit embarked from Sydney, New South Wales, on board HMAT A16 Star Of Victoria on 20 October 1914 |
| Rank from Nominal Roll | Sergeant |
| Unit from Nominal Roll | l H BMG Sqd |
| Fate | Returned to Australia 15 November 1918 |
